> On Sat, Mar 01, 2014 at 05:45:46PM +0100, Carlo Caione wrote:
> > This patch introduces the preliminary support for PMICs X-Powers AXP202
> > and AXP209. The AXP209 and AXP202 are the PMUs (Power Management Unit)
> > used by A10, A13 and A20 SoCs and developed by X-Powers, a sister company
> > of Allwinner.
> > 
> > The core enables support for two subsystems:
> > - PEK (Power Enable Key)
> > - Regulators
> >

> > +   if (axp20x->pm_off && !pm_power_off) {
> > +           axp20x_pm_power_off = axp20x;
> > +           pm_power_off = axp20x_power_off;
> > +   }
> 
> I don't think we have any other way to actually power down the board.
> 
> Is there any reason why we would not need this property?

In case you have multiple PMIC on the board in this way you con define
which is the one apt to power off.
